Childhood SA: Trauma Research 

Greater Manchester | Work In Progress

An ongoing research project centred on the lived experiences of adults who have survived childhood sexual abuse. I am currently developing partnerships with research organisations, support groups and community organisations across Greater Manchester to explore what support is currently available, where gaps exist, and how creative practice might contribute to understanding and wellbeing. 

The project will use creative methodologies including visual research, oral histories and participatory sessions to explore the long-term effects of childhood sexual abuse and the experiences of navigating recovery and support. A key area of enquiry is whether creative and community-based approaches can help alleviate some of the ongoing impacts and improve wellbeing for survivors.
